Iliana multiplied 3p – 7 and 2p2 – 3p – 4. Her work is shown in the table.
The expression (3 p minus 7)(2 p squared minus 3 p minus 4) is shown above a table with 3 columns and 2 rows. First column is labeled 2 p squared, second column is labeled negative 3 p, the third column is labeled negative 4. First row is labeled 3 p with entries 6 p cubed, negative 9 p squared, negative 12 p. Second row is labeled negative 7 with entries negative 14 p squared, 21 p, 28.
Which is the product?
6p3 + 23p2 + 9p + 28
6p3 – 23p2 – 9p + 28
6p3 – 23p2 + 9p + 28
6p3 + 23p2 – 9p + 28

Multiply each column and combine like terms:
6p^3 + (−9p^2 − 14p^2) + (−12p + 21p) + 28 = 6p^3 − 23p^2 + 9p + 28.
So the product is 6p^3 − 23p^2 + 9p + 28 (third choice).
